  5. Workforce productivity - Wikipedia

    en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Workforce_productivity

    Workforce productivity is the amount of goods and services that a group of workers produce in a given amount of time. It is one of several types of productivity that economists measure. Workforce productivity, often referred to as labor productivity , is a measure for an organisation or company, a process, an industry, or a country.

  7. Work measurement - Wikipedia

    en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Work_measurement

    Work measurement helps to uncover non-standardization that exist in the workplace and non-value adding activities and waste. A work has to be measured for the following reasons: To discover and eliminate lost or ineffective time. To establish standard times for performance measurement. To measure performance against realistic expectations.
